I am so fortunate to live within a 2 hour drive of the town of Banff. The country here is so beautiful.
Lake Louise and Field are close enough to Banff that you can easily visit all three places from one base, there's no need to pack up and move from hotel to hotel. Its about a 45 minute drive from Banff to Lake Louise, and Field is about another 20 minutes or so past LL.
Jasper is a different story. It is about a 3 hour drive from LL to Jasper, with the Columbia Icefields about midway between the two. You should plan on a full day to travel the Icefields Parkway, there are so many things to see along the way. I would strongly urge anyone planning on visiting Jasper to spend a few nights in Jasper as well. The travelling distance is great enough that you could never do justice to Jasper on a day trip from Banff.
My suggestion would be to allow a minimum of 3 days in Banff area, 1 day to travel from Banff to Jasper, and 2 days in Jasper, if your schedule permits this.
Now that I have established the closeness of LL and Field to Banff, you will understand why all my tips for all 3 areas are being headed up under Banff. It makes it a lot simpler for everyone to see what you can easily see in a day trip from Banff or LL.
